Which word most accurately describes an artifact from the 12th century?

English
2 answers:
Firlakuza [10]3 years ago
4 0

Answer: Ancient

"Ancient" is most commonly used to describe something that dates from a long time past in historical or archaeological terms. This would be the most accurate way to describe an artifact from the 12th century. "Aged" is most often used in the case of things that are purposefully brought to their point of maturity, such as wine and cheese. "Geriatric" is a word that refers to the elderly, while "old" describes any item that has existed for a long time, or that cannot be called "new" any longer.
